Ethereum
Block
21266563
0x56b7e9a5e06e27fed970fa25822ea4a0692f9529
EOA
Active on
Ethereum with -- and
891 txns
Funded by
0xb3aa
…
3a39
via
0xde7f
…
a719
First active
6 years ago
Last active
4 years ago
Loading...